Roof repair costs depend on several specific factors. The size of the damaged area is the biggest variable, along with the accessibility of your roof and the pitch or steepness involved. We also look at the underlying materials—like whether you have standard asphalt shingles, metal, or tile—and the complexity of the flashing around chimneys or vents. If the wood decking underneath is rotted or damaged, that adds to the labor and material needs. We provide ex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

Rubber roofing, particularly EPDM membranes, offers excellent durability in Burbank's climate due to its high resistance to UV radiation and significant temperature fluctuations. It remains flexible, preventing cracking and leaks that can occur with other materials under thermal stress. Professional installation ensures a watertight seal, providing a robust and long-lasting solution for flat or low-slope roofs.
Polycarbonate roof panels can be a suitable option for certain applications in Burbank, offering good impact resistance and light transmission. However, their performance can be affected by intense UV exposure over time, potentially leading to yellowing or brittleness. When considering these panels, it's important to ensure they have UV protective coatings and are installed with proper sealing to prevent leaks and maintain their integrity against the local climate.

The best roofing materials for Burbank balance durability against sun exposure and temperature fluctuations. High-impact asphalt shingles with good UV resistance, metal roofing with reflective coatings, and robust single-ply membranes like TPO or EPDM are excellent choices. These materials are chosen for their longevity and ability to withstand the specific environmental conditions of the area, ensuring reliable protection for your property.
